Check Out Ryah Jay’s Story

Today we’d like to introduce you to Ryah Jay.

Ryah, we appreciate you taking the time to share your story with us today. Where does your story begin?
I’ve always loved beauty and the art of it. My true love was makeup and I would always do my mom’s makeup before she went out with her friends. As I got older I realized I was also in love with skincare! I decided to go to school to become an Esthetician. While in school my teacher told me she’d think I’d make a great lash artist. I looked at her like she was crazy not knowing the next 3 years it would become something I was really good at. I moved to Los Angeles and serviced my first celebrity clientele. After getting pregnant with my son I moved back to Kansas City where I’ve serviced over 200 clients and mentored other lash artists in the area.

Alright, so let’s dig a little deeper into the story – has it been an easy path overall and if not, what were the challenges you’ve had to overcome?
Oh yes. Motherhood is a big part of my entrepreneurial journey. When I first started esthetics school I found out I was 8 weeks pregnant with my first baby. Unfortunately, a few weeks later I miscarried. I didn’t want to fall into my depression even though I was grieving. I finished school and later that next year became pregnant again. This was at the mid part of my lash career. I was excited and carried all the way to 5 months and lost my second baby. So having my son and my career peak at the same time has been a beautiful journey. Though not smooth I wouldn’t change a thing about it.

As you know, we’re big fans of you and your work. For our readers who might not be as familiar what can you tell them about what you do?
I specialize in everything beauty. In 2021 I made MHLF (Milf) Beauty an LLC. Standing for makeup, hair removal, lashes & facials I love to provide the Ultimate experience. I do makeup, waxing, facials and I’m known as the Fairy Lash Muva. You love bold, volume lashes? I’m your girl! I am most proud of my clean lash line and styles. What sets me apart is my energy! It’s important my clients leave relaxed and confident. Currently I added healing work to my lash sessions. Starting a new business with my son as part owner Herbs N’ Harlem is a healing salt business that promotes relaxation and helps ease anxiety.
